Description Mantas Mikulėnas (grawity) 2015-04-01 16:59:03 UTC
Created attachment 300769 [details]
screenshot

Full-screen programs no longer set the background correctly (see screenshot), leaving black areas until manual redraw (Ctrl-L).

This broke somewhere between 0.40.0-2-g3291b87 and 0.40.0-7-g450bf25.

(Screenshot is of vim 7.4.663; $TERM is xterm-256color.)
Comment 1 Egmont Koblinger 2015-04-01 22:45:15 UTC
Indeed, broken by 450bf25. Will fix soon; thanks for the report!
Comment 2 Egmont Koblinger 2015-04-01 23:02:25 UTC
Looks nontrivial to fix (at least nontrivial at 1pm :D). Reverted for now, let's continue the investigation in bug 506438.
